Remark:

Emoticons are a fun, shorthand way of expressing your feelings.You can select
the most appropriate Emoticon from the grid and add them to your message.

Templates are a selection of common, ready to use statements which are easy to
insert into your message. These are:Please call - I’ll be there at - What time will
you be home? - I’ll call you - Happy Birthday! -
You can change these templates and replace them with your own.See (See § “9.9
Changing templates” )

9.1.2 How to send an SMS

Enter the message to be send

When finished select OPTIONS. The following options appears beside above mentioned
options:

Send To

Save

Notify

Message Type

OK

Select Send To and press OK to confirm.

Enter the correspondent’s number if you don’t want to use the phonebook memory

OR

Delete the number that appears on the display by pressing Clear and select Search to

search the number in the phonebook. Select the name by using the

or

keys.

Select Send start sending the SMS. The display will show Sending SMS.

OR

Select Back to modify the message before sending it

OR

Press and hold Clear or Back to delete the message without sending or press

. The

message is totally erased and the phone will return to standby

9.1.3 Save a message

When finnished writing a message select Options and then Save.

Confirm with OK. Your message is saved in the Draft list.

9.1.4 Notify message

When you send a message and you want to have a delivery notification, you have to turn this
function on. Some networks/operators always sends a delivery notification even when this
option is turned ON or OFF.

When finished writing a message select Option and then Notify.

Select ON to get a delivery notification or Off if you don’t want it and press OK.

Only works if the network support this function!
